你查询的IP:[117.24.59.86]  地理位置:中国–福建–泉州

最新查询120.220.231.91 58.144.59.103 58.66.28.232 119.10.77.107 123.52.215.49 116.198.233.39 121.16.144.102 222.32.11.191 221.130.139.175 117.24.59.86 60.208.134.60 122.64.184.234 124.242.125.252 210.72.223.45 203.142.219.60 203.208.32.244 203.110.160.40 121.52.160.105 118.88.128.132 119.57.212.119 114.28.250.184 119.19.50.81 202.136.48.132 119.253.91.26 114.80.249.57 202.127.48.100 122.102.64.173 124.240.142.42 118.224.241.138 123.56.150.3 123.64.145.42